Unveiling the subtleties of Nishiki's white Rice
I've been using Nishiki premium Sushi Rice for my homemade sushi dishes, and the results have been incredibly satisfying.This medium grain rice is specially selected and processed using advanced milling technology, which really enhances its natural flavor and texture. Each 1/4 cup serving of uncooked rice provides 150 calories, 3 grams of protein, and 33 grams of carbohydrates, making it a nutritious option as well.What I love most is that it's Non-GMO Project certified, Kosher, and free from fat, cholesterol, and sodium. Preparing it is effortless—just add water and cook. the consistency is perfect for rolling and shaping sushi, and the taste is pure and wholesome.The packaging is sturdy and convenient, especially with the 10-pound bag size, which offers great value for frequent sushi makers. The rice grains hold their shape well during cooking, resulting in fluffy and tender rice that complements seafood and vegetables beautifully. It's a versatile option for other dishes too, such as stir-fries or rice bowls. The only minor downside is that it can be a bit pricey compared to regular rice, but the quality makes it worth the investment for me.
